Appropriate Preposition:

  • Listen to ( শোনা ) Listen to the news on the radio.
  • Different from ( পৃথক ) This book is different from that.
  • Popular with ( জনপ্রিয় ) He is popular with all for his good behaviour.
  • Similar to ( সদৃশ ) This pen is similar to that.
  • Die by ( মারা যাওয়া (বিষ) ) He died by poison.
  • Responsible to ( দায়ী (প্রাধিকার) ) He is responsible to the committee for his action.
